Story summary
- Nutrition can boost cognitive health and motor function in children with Cerebral Palsy (CP), says Dr. Sujith Kumar N of Apollo Hospitals.
- Omega-3s, iron, zinc, and B vitamins support brain development.
- Deficiencies may impair cognition.
- The ketogenic diet can reduce seizures in drug-resistant epilepsy, but requires medical supervision.
- Many children with CP face feeding challenges and need professional nutritional guidance.
